About us
Who we are and what we do

is a photonic deep-tech scale-up developing photonic processing solutions that compute natively with light and deliver a scalable alternative to transistor-based systems. Its Light Empowered Native Arithmetics (LENA) architecture delivers analog co-processing power optimised for complex computation and enabling energy-efficient performance for next-generation AI and HPC applications. operates its own Thin-Film Lithium Niobate (TFLN) chip pilot line in collaboration with the Institute for Microelectronics Stuttgart IMS CHIPS and is currently shipping its Native Processing Servers to selected partners. was founded by Michael Förtsch in 2018 and is headquartered in Stuttgart Germany.
